Print Page | Close Window

ExtractFilePagesEx fails - RenderPageToFile works

Printed From: Debenu Quick PDF Library - PDF SDK Community Forum
Category: For Users of the Library
Forum Name: General Discussion
Forum Description: Discussion board for Debenu Quick PDF Library and Debenu PDF Viewer SDK
URL: http://www.quickpdf.org/forum/forum_posts.asp?TID=3693
Printed Date: 28 Apr 24 at 5:32PM
Software Version: Web Wiz Forums 11.01 - http://www.webwizforums.com


Topic: ExtractFilePagesEx fails - RenderPageToFile works
Posted By: quickpdfdeveloper
Subject: ExtractFilePagesEx fails - RenderPageToFile works
Date Posted: 16 Apr 19 at 9:00AM
I am using DPL 16.12. I have a PDF that uses XFA forms.

When I save a page using DARenderPageToFile it saves a PNG image perfectly, both form and the data that's been filled in.

But when I save a page as a PDF using ExtractFilePagesEx, only the form is saved, with _none_ of the data that's been filled in.

Is it possible to make ExtractFilePagesEx save both the form _and_ the data? Or is there an equivalent function that will do this?



Replies:
Posted By: swb1
Date Posted: 16 Apr 19 at 1:12PM
Just a wild guess... Have you tried FlattenAllFormFields prior to the ExtractFilePagesEx?


Posted By: quickpdfdeveloper
Date Posted: 16 Apr 19 at 2:26PM
Thank you!
That sounds like just what I need.
I'll give it a try.

I tried it and after some false starts I got it working. Thank you!

(I found the QPL tool that has editable examples of JavaScript very helpful for testing.)


Posted By: Ingo
Date Posted: 16 Apr 19 at 6:17PM
Hi,

if you read in the form functions section you'll see that xfa-forms are not completely supported.
Here's a kb-note from Debenu regarding xfa and non-xfa.
This will make it a bit clearer:
https://www.debenu.com/kb/can-debenu-quick-pdf-library-print-pdf-forms-use-xfa-form-fields/



-------------
Cheers,
Ingo




Print Page | Close Window

Forum Software by Web Wiz Forums® version 11.01 - http://www.webwizforums.com
Copyright ©2001-2014 Web Wiz Ltd. - http://www.webwiz.co.uk